Award-winning author Dia Calhoun will offer a free writing workshop and a reading and book signing Saturday (Oct. 12) at Trail’s End Bookstore.
The workshop, geared to children 8-12 years old, will be from 3-4:30 p.m. Calhoun writes young adult fiction, and some of her work is inspired by the Methow Valley. She spends a month here each summer writing at a family orchard near the town of Methow.
Her two most recent works, After the River the Sun and Eva of the Farm, are set in the Methow Valley and include familiar scenes. Calhoun will be signing these and other works on Saturday.
